Jul.23     Pope meets Bush
  John Paul II has urged U.S. President to reject medical research on human embryos
Jul.24   War role inquiry suspended  Jewish and Catholic historians have suspended research because the Vatican has failed to open archives

Sep.22   Pope brings message of peace
  John Paul has starts visit to Kazakhstan with a call for negotiation to settle conflicts   Pope urges harmony between faiths  John Paul II in the Kazakhstan capital Astana calls for harmony between Christians and Muslims Sep.24   Pope's Armenia trip threatens row  John Paul II will meet the President Kocharian, and pay a visit to a memorial to Armenians killed in massacres in Turkey Sep.26   Pope avoids Armenia controversy
  John Paul II avoids the word 'genocide' for ethnic Armenians who died at the hands of Ottoman Turks in 1915
